3步攻克魔兽争霸3兼容性难题:WarcraftHelper实战指南
3步攻克魔兽争霸3兼容性难题WarcraftHelper实战指南【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per还在为经典游戏魔兽争霸3在现代Windows系统上频繁崩溃、画面撕裂而烦恼吗WarcraftHelper作为一款专业的魔兽争霸3兼容性工具专门解决从Windows 10到Windows 11的各种兼容性问题让这款经典的RTS游戏重新焕发活力。无论你是老玩家重温经典还是新玩家首次体验这款工具都能为你提供流畅的游戏体验。问题诊断为什么你的魔兽争霸3运行异常魔兽争霸3作为20年前的经典游戏在现代操作系统上面临着诸多技术挑战。这些问题并非偶然而是技术演进的必然结果。核心兼容性问题深度剖析游戏启动崩溃现象Windows 10/11的安全机制与旧版游戏冲突导致DirectX调用失败。症状表现为游戏启动后立即闪退连主菜单都无法进入。显示适配困境现代显示器普遍采用16:9或16:10比例而魔兽争霸3原生支持4:3。直接拉伸会导致界面元素错位、文字重叠严重影响游戏体验。性能锁死瓶颈游戏默认锁定60FPS在高刷新率显示器上造成画面卡顿。特别是在144Hz、240Hz电竞显示器上这种限制尤为明显。文件系统兼容性中文路径支持不足导致地图加载失败、存档丢失。Windows系统的编码处理方式变化使得旧版游戏无法正确识别Unicode路径。内存管理限制8MB地图大小限制阻碍了大型自定义地图的发展限制了玩家社区的创造力。解决方案模块化能力矩阵设计WarcraftHelper采用模块化架构每个功能独立运行支持按需组合使用。以下是核心能力模块的技术解析宽屏支持模块 ⭐️问题现象游戏界面拉伸变形UI元素错位文字显示不全。技术原理通过Hook DirectX渲染管线动态计算正确的宽高比重新布局界面元素。核心代码位于WarcraftHelper/plugin/widescreen.cpp实现了智能比例适配算法。配置方法[Options] WideScreen true AspectRatio auto # 可选16:9, 16:10, auto效果验证启动游戏后检查游戏界面是否保持正确比例UI元素是否正常显示。FPS解锁与优化模块 ⭐️⭐️问题现象游戏帧率锁定在60FPS高刷新率显示器无法发挥性能优势。技术原理修改游戏内部的帧率限制逻辑同时集成智能帧率管理算法。WarcraftHelper/plugin/unlockfps.cpp实现了核心解锁逻辑fpslimiter.cpp提供可配置的帧率上限控制。配置矩阵配置项推荐值适用场景性能影响UnlockFPStrue所有版本释放GPU性能TargetFps144144Hz显示器平衡性能与功耗FpsLimittrue笔记本用户降低功耗发热验证方法游戏中按F10键显示实时FPS计数器确认帧率已突破60限制。中文路径修复模块 ⭐️问题现象中文目录下的地图无法加载游戏存档丢失。技术原理拦截文件系统调用进行编码转换和路径标准化处理。WarcraftHelper/plugin/pathfix.cpp实现了完整的Unicode路径支持。WarcraftHelper中文路径修复功能解决了文件系统兼容性问题配置检查点创建中文目录的测试地图验证游戏能否正常加载和保存。地图大小限制解除模块 ⭐️⭐️问题现象超过8MB的自定义地图无法加载大型RPG地图无法运行。技术原理修改游戏内存分配策略扩展地图缓冲区大小。WarcraftHelper/plugin/sizebypass.cpp实现了动态内存管理机制。技术参数对比版本原始限制WarcraftHelper支持提升幅度1.20e8MB128MB16倍1.24e8MB256MB32倍1.27a/b8MB512MB64倍实战演示从零到一的完整部署流程环境准备与工具获取系统要求检查清单Windows 10或Windows 11操作系统魔兽争霸3任意版本1.20e/1.24e/1.26a/1.27a/1.27b至少100MB可用磁盘空间获取WarcraftHelper工具包git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per检查点提问克隆完成后确认WarcraftHelper目录包含哪些核心文件游戏目录定位与文件部署常见游戏安装路径C:\Program Files\Warcraft IIID:\Games\Warcraft IIISteam版本Steam\steamapps\common\Warcraft III核心文件部署矩阵文件名称功能作用部署位置重要性WarcraftHelper.dll核心插件游戏根目录必需WarcraftHelper.ini配置文件游戏根目录必需d3d9.dllDirectX兼容层游戏根目录推荐关键操作首次运行必须使用窗口化模式启动游戏确保插件正确写入注册表数据。配置调优与功能验证基础配置模板[Options] # 核心功能开关 UnlockFPS true ShowFPS true WideScreen true UnlockMapSize true # 性能优化 AutoSaveReplay true FpsLimit true TargetFps 144 # 兼容性修复 PathFix true ShowHPBar true版本适配策略游戏版本推荐配置特别注意事项1.20eShowHPBar true建议配合d3d8to9补丁使用1.24eWideScreen true宽屏支持效果最佳1.26a全功能开启兼容性最好1.27a/bUnlockFPS true帧率解锁效果最明显验证机制每个配置项调整后重启游戏验证功能是否生效。进阶定制从使用者到贡献者的成长路径高级配置技巧 ⭐️⭐️性能优化配置[Advanced] # 内存管理优化 MemoryPoolSize 256 CacheSize 64 # 渲染优化 VSync false TripleBuffering true # 网络优化 PacketOptimization true场景化配置方案电竞对战场景TargetFps 240 ShowFPS true InputLagReduction true怀旧体验场景TargetFps 60 # 保持原汁原味 WideScreen false # 使用原始比例源码编译与自定义开发 ⭐️⭐️⭐️编译环境搭建# 生成构建文件 cmake . -A win32 -B build # 编译项目 cmake --build build --config MinSizeRel项目架构解析WarcraftHelper/ ├── config/ # 配置解析与管理系统 ├── game/ # 游戏版本检测与适配 ├── plugin/ # 功能插件实现模块 └── d3d9/ # DirectX兼容层封装自定义插件开发指南创建新插件模板参考WarcraftHelper/plugin/autorep.cpp实现标准接口注册插件功能在plugin.hpp中添加插件声明配置系统集成通过config.hpp暴露配置选项技术检查点编译完成后验证build/output目录是否包含所有必需文件。故障排查四步诊断法症状识别→根因分析→修复实施→预防措施常见问题矩阵症状可能根因修复方案预防措施游戏闪退注册表写入失败以管理员权限运行首次使用窗口化模式界面显示异常宽屏适配冲突按F7刷新窗口正确配置AspectRatio中文路径失效编码转换失败检查PathFix配置避免特殊字符路径帧率不稳定显卡驱动冲突更新显卡驱动启用FpsLimit功能兼容性矩阵与最佳实践功能支持全景图功能特性1.20e1.24e1.26a1.27a1.27b配置复杂度解锁地图大小限制✅✅✅✅✅⭐️宽屏支持✅✅✅✅✅⭐️解锁FPS✅✅✅✅✅⭐️⭐️自动保存录像✅✅✅✅✅⭐️中文路径修复✅✅✅✅✅⭐️自动显血✅游戏自带游戏自带游戏自带游戏自带⭐️FPS限制器❌❌❌✅✅⭐️⭐️立即尝试根据你的游戏版本选择对应的配置方案开始优化社区联动与持续改进用户场景征集分享你的使用场景帮助我们完善功能适配多显示器配置优化需求特殊分辨率支持请求网络对战延迟优化建议扩展接口预留WarcraftHelper提供了完整的插件开发接口支持社区贡献新功能模块。参考WarcraftHelper/plugin/plugin.hpp了解插件开发规范。情感锚点告别兼容性烦恼解放双手专注于游戏乐趣。WarcraftHelper不仅仅是一个工具更是连接经典游戏与现代系统的桥梁。最终验证完成所有配置后运行一场完整的对战录像验证所有功能协同工作的稳定性。记住经典永不褪色只需要正确的工具让它重新发光【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2590390.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!